Music

Year 7 Music homework is set once per half term and can be found on Google Classroom https://classroom.google.com/  Pupils are also asked to write their homework in their planner during their music lesson. 

Each homework task is designed to extend understanding of a musical topic or provide a wider understanding of musical genre. Tasks will vary but could include elements such as listening, research, or learning and applying key words.
